In 1700, Martha BORDEN entered the world in Lyme, New London Co., Connecticut, born to John Borden Ii And Marah Borden. Martha BORDEN married Thomas Tanner I, and had children including Ruth Tanner, Thomas Tanner Ii. Martha BORDEN passed away in 1753 in Cornwall, Litchfield Co., Connecticut.
